Definition of Boric Acid

  • 1. A white or colorless slightly acid solid that is soluble in water and ethanol; used in the manufacture of glass and paper and adhesives and in detergents and as a flux in welding; also used as an antiseptic and food preservative Noun
  • 2. Any of various acids containing boron and oxygen Noun
